Definition of Market:



The vitrectomy devices market comprises all the instruments, systems, and consumables used in vitrectomy procedures. A vitrectomy is a surgical procedure performed to remove the vitreous humor, a gel-like substance that fills the eye, to treat various retinal diseases. The components include: Vitrectomy machines: These are the central units that control the cutting, aspiration, and infusion processes during surgery. Instruments: This includes various cutting instruments (e.g., blades, probes), aspiration probes, illumination systems (e.g., fiber optic light sources), and infusion cannulas to maintain intraocular pressure. Consumables: These are disposable items like infusion fluids, cannulas, and other accessories used during each procedure. Software and accessories: Software aids in surgical planning and data analysis, while accessories improve surgical precision and ergonomics. Key terms associated with the market include: 25-gauge vitrectomy, 27-gauge vitrectomy, transconjunctival vitrectomy, sclerotomy, pneumatic retinopexy, intraocular pressure, vitreous hemorrhage, and retinal detachment. By Type:


  • 25-gauge and smaller vitrectomy systems: These minimally invasive systems have become the standard of care, offering benefits like smaller incisions, reduced trauma, and faster recovery times. The smaller gauge systems often integrate advanced features enhancing precision and efficiency during surgery. Their adoption continues to grow due to their improved outcomes and reduced patient discomfort. The segment is expected to witness substantial growth in the forecast period, driven by increasing awareness among ophthalmologists and patients alike.


  • 20-gauge and larger vitrectomy systems: These traditional systems still maintain a niche market. Although they are less commonly used now, some specific surgical cases may still require the wider access offered by larger-gauge instruments. This segments market share is likely to decline as smaller-gauge systems become more versatile and capable of addressing a wider array of surgical needs.


  • Accessories and consumables: This segment includes various disposable and reusable accessories such as infusion cannulas, cutting instruments, aspiration probes, and specialized forceps. The high volume of single-use accessories contributes significantly to the markets revenue stream, and innovations in this area focused on enhancing functionality and reducing costs will drive growth.




By Application:


  • Diabetic retinopathy: This accounts for a substantial portion of the market due to the increasing prevalence of diabetes worldwide. Vitrectomy is crucial in treating the vision-threatening complications of diabetic retinopathy, making it a key application area for vitrectomy devices.


  • Retinal detachment: Vitrectomy is a primary treatment for retinal detachment, a condition that can lead to permanent vision loss. The effectiveness of vitrectomy in repairing retinal tears and reattaching the retina makes this a significant driver for market growth.


  • Macular degeneration and other retinal diseases: Vitrectomy plays a role in the management of age-related macular degeneration (AMD) and other retinal conditions like epiretinal membranes and macular holes. This diverse range of applications reinforces the markets overall growth.




By End User:


  • Hospitals and ophthalmic clinics: These are the primary end-users of vitrectomy devices, with larger hospitals often employing a wider range of equipment and technologies. The growth of specialized ophthalmic clinics further expands the market.


  • Ambulatory surgical centers (ASCs): The increasing adoption of ASCs for ophthalmic procedures is influencing the market, creating a demand for smaller, more efficient vitrectomy systems suitable for this setting.


  • Research institutions: Research and development in vitrectomy techniques and device advancements drives innovation within the market and shapes future trends. These institutions contribute to the overall market growth by testing and validating new technologies.
